Description

Mebendazole is a benzimidazole anti-parasitic/anti-helminthic compound that also exhibits anticancer chemotherapeutic activity. Mebendazole inhibits microtubule polymerization in parasitic worms. In melanoma cells, mebendazole decreases levels of Bcl-2 and induces apoptosis, suppressing cell growth. This compound also decreases Bcl-2 and XIAP levels in vivo, suppressing growth of melanoma xenografts.

Product Info

Cas No.

31431-39-7

Purity

≥98%

Formula

C16H13N3O3

Formula Wt.

295.29

Chemical Name

(5-Benzoyl-1H-benzimidazole-2-yl)carbamic acid methyl ester

IUPAC Name

methyl N-(6-benzoyl-1H-benzimidazol-2-yl)carbamate

Synonym

Mebendazol, Lomper, Noverme, Pantelmin

Melting Point

288.5°C

Solubility

Soluble in formic acid. Practically insoluble in water, ethanol, ether and chloroform.

Appearance

Off white or yellowish powder
